Découper une archive tar ou un fichier quelconque en plusieurs morceaux

Voici comment découper une archive tar par exemple en plusieurs segments d’une taille définie.

La commande magique qui va réussir cette opération se nomme : split

Contexte : vous avez une archive tgz qui pèse par exemple 759 Mo.

Afin de faciliter son transfert ou pour tout autre raison, vous avec besoin de découpé cette archive en petit bout de 100Mo.

Rien de plus simple avec split :)

Nous allons considérer que l’archive s’appelle toto.tgz.

Voici la ligne de commande qui va bien :

split --line-bytes=100m toto.tgz toto_ &

Cela va faire quelques fichiers (8 dans notre exemple) préfixés à la fin par aa, le suivant ab, le suivant ac etc etc

Pour les rassembler, rien de plus simple. La commande « cat » est notre ami :)

cat toto_a* > toto_FULL.tar.gz

Article lu 2881 fois

Laisser un commentaire